Groups Starting Back: August 5, 2018 Lesson book: Psalms, Prayers of the Heart What’s different? The Elders have given the church the mission of “Walking hand in hand with Jesus while reaching out to others” and want the Connection Groups to dedicate one meeting time per month to specifically plan an event that “reaches out to others.” This can have many forms. Ideas I have heard so far include nursing home visits, in- viting friends to activities organized around interests/hobbies (i.e. Plan, for example, a photography hike so you can invite friends with the same interest, thereby introducing them to members of our church and begin- ning relationships on which to build, both to serve them and to invite them to visit your group or our worship service.), planning a neighbor- hood cook-out/meal to invite neighbors to meet others in your group. These events may be scheduled any time during the week and would re- place the regular Connection Group bible study for that week. (You’ll have a book so you can study on your own for that lesson.) The intent is that we are making conscious efforts to reach out to others, be- yond our groups, to strengthen and to help grow the church. Groups can join efforts to enhance success. Those that have not been involved in Connection Groups are also invited to participate. The effort is that everyone is working together to build the church.
